Qatar Airways tickets come with different levels of flexibility, and the fare type you choose—whether in Economy, Business, or First Class directly affects your ability to cancel and receive a refund. The airline typically categorizes fares into Lite, Classic, Convenience, Comfort, and Elite levels, each offering varying degrees of refundability. In the Economy Class segment, for example, the Lite fare is the most restrictive and generally non-refundable except for airport taxes. Classic or Convenience fares may allow cancellations for a fee, while Comfort fares are more flexible and usually allow partial refunds after deducting cancellation charges. In Business and First Class, the same structure applies, although the higher-end fares like Business Elite or First Elite are often fully refundable, especially if canceled within the airline’s specified time frame before departure.

Cancellation fees apply to most refundable tickets unless you purchased a completely flexible fare. These fees vary depending on your route, fare class, and how close to the departure date you initiate the cancellation. For instance, if you cancel a partially refundable Economy Classic ticket a few days before your scheduled departure, you may be charged anywhere from $100 to $300, with the rest of the amount refunded to your original method of payment. In Business Class, the cancellation fees can be higher between $200 and $500 depending on the fare type and destination. The key to avoiding substantial penalties is to cancel as early as possible, ideally more than 24–48 hours before departure.

Another factor that influences your refund eligibility is the method you used to book your flight. If you booked directly through Qatar Airways via their website, mobile app, or customer service center you can manage your booking online and request a cancellation or refund using their “Manage Booking” feature. This process allows you to view the exact refund amount before confirming the cancellation. On the other hand, if you booked your ticket through a third-party website or travel agency, you must go through that intermediary to initiate the cancellation and request a refund. Qatar Airways generally does not process refunds for third-party bookings unless the cancellation is due to involuntary reasons, such as a flight being canceled or significantly delayed by the airline.

In cases where Qatar Airways cancels your flight, changes the schedule significantly, or causes a major disruption beyond your control, you are entitled to a full refund regardless of the fare class. These scenarios are considered “involuntary cancellations,” and the airline is obligated under international aviation regulations to provide either a full refund or an alternative flight at no extra cost. This applies even to non-refundable tickets. If you are impacted by a flight cancellation, Qatar Airways usually notifies passengers via email or text message and provides rebooking or refund options directly. You can opt to take the next available flight, rebook at a later date, or request a full refund to your original form of payment.

In special cases, such as a medical emergency or death of the passenger or an immediate family member, Qatar Airways may make exceptions and offer a full refund or waive cancellation penalties. To qualify for these special considerations, you must provide valid supporting documentation, such as a medical certificate or death certificate. The airline evaluates each case individually and reserves the right to grant or deny a refund based on the evidence provided. If your visa application was denied by the destination country and you have documentation to prove it, you may also be eligible for a refund, particularly if the cancellation is made well before the departure date.

Qatar Airways also offers flexibility through travel credits. If your ticket is non-refundable or only partially refundable, you may have the option to convert the remaining value into a travel voucher. These vouchers are typically valid for up to 12 months from the date of issue and can be used toward future travel with the airline. This is a useful option if you cancel a flight for personal reasons but still plan to travel at a later date. During the COVID-19 pandemic, Qatar Airways introduced very flexible change and refund policies, including unlimited date changes and full refunds regardless of fare type. While these lenient policies have mostly expired, they demonstrated the airline’s willingness to accommodate passengers during global crises, and similar flexibility may be offered during other significant travel disruptions.

If you’re a member of Qatar Airways’ frequent flyer program, Privilege Club, and you used Qmiles to book your ticket, the refund process differs slightly. Award tickets can generally be canceled and the miles re-deposited into your account, provided the cancellation is made at least three hours before departure. There is usually a service fee associated with this process, which ranges between $25 and $50. Taxes and fees paid in cash during the booking process may also be refunded, minus any applicable cancellation charges. If you fail to cancel in time or don’t show up for the flight, your miles and money may be forfeited entirely.

Refund processing times vary depending on the payment method used. In most cases, Qatar Airways processes eligible refunds within 7 to 28 business days. Credit card refunds may take longer due to bank processing times, while refunds through online wallets or direct debit may be quicker. It's important to retain all documentation related to your cancellation such as confirmation emails, cancellation receipts, and payment proofs as they may be required if you need to follow up on a delayed refund.
